First published in 1922, 'The Red House Mystery' is a mystery novel by A.A. Milne, an English author popular for his books about the teddy bear Winnie-the-Pooh and children's poetry. Milne was mainly a playwright before the tremendous sensation of Pooh outweighed all his earlier work. The story takes its readers to the Red House, a relaxing dwelling in the quiet English countryside that is the bachelor home of Mr. Mark Ablett. While seeing this comfortable place, non-expert detective Anthony Gillingham and his chum, Bill Beverley, investigate their gracious host's disappearance and its association with an evasive shooting. Between sophisticated pursuits, Gillingham and Beverley examine the chances in a light-hearted series of stunts interesting secret passageways, underwater proof, and other atmospheric devices. Glistening with humorous dialogue, masterful plotting, and a fascinating cast of characters, this rare treasure will delight mystery lovers.
